DISCOVERING | Big Buck Night in Baraga County, New Mandatory Turkey Harvest Reporting
Episode 179 - Baraga County U.P. Whitetails held their second annual Big Buck Night where hunters from anywhere in the U.P. could bring their buck to be scored by Commemorative Bucks of Michigan. Plus the weigh-in for their annual predator challenge was held the same night. New this year for spring turkey hunters is mandatory harvest reporting. I talked to the DNR about why.
